Former 98 Degrees crooner Nick Lachey and his wife, Vanessa Minnillo Lachey, have listed their Encino, CA, home for sale. The six-bed, eight-bath spread sits in the San Fernando Valley town, and the couple have lived there since 2011 (they bought the property for $2.85 million). Now they’ve added a $3.995 million price tag. I know, I was hoping for a “98” in there too.

Built in 1981, the 8,134-square-foot contemporary Mediterranean property is tucked away on a cul-de-sac, behind gates and lush greenery. With the style of a transitional Montecito home, the home has soaring ceilings, exposed beams, and an open floor plan throughout the spacious main level. A formal living room, media room, formal dining room, and large family room provide lots of space for a growing family — Nick and Vanessa have two children — while the chef’s kitchen, which has a butler’s pantry and a breakfast area, can accommodate any aspiring chef.

With a flat, grassy yard, pool house, and outdoor sitting areas, the property is well-suited for entertaining. But the crown jewel of the property is the master suite: In addition to his-and-hers closets and a spacious master bath, it has a separate sitting room and office.
